In Florida, 5 colleges are offering Dietetics/Dietitian programsin both undergraduate and graduate levels
The 2025 average undergraduate tuition & fees of the Dietetics/Dietitian program is $6,357 for state residents and $22,754 for out-of-state students.
3 Florida graduate schools offer the Dietetics/Dietitian programs and the average graduate tuition & fees is $10,750 for state residents and $24,359 for out-of-state students.

5 Florida colleges have the Dietetics/Dietitian program. By school type, there are 4 public and 1 private schools offering Dietetics/Dietitian program.
